In this context, a drive-in cinema created on one of the roofs of the largest shopping center in Dubai has been played.

In the United Arab Emirates, social distancing to stop the spread of the covid-19 virus is inexcusable.

To comply with social distancing, only two spectators per car will be allowed in the drive-in cinema

This drive-in cinema initiative will only open on Sundays and has a capacity of up to seventy-five cars per shift.

The company in charge of carrying out this initiative is called VOX Cinemas. The cost of the tickets is 180 dirhams which is equivalent to fifty dollars per vehicle. This already includes a combo of candy and drinks.

This drive-in cinema will be located on the terrace of the Majid Al Futtaim Shopping Center.

Relaxation of the quarantine in Dubai

In the city of Dubai the limitations due to coronaviruses have been relaxed since Ramadan, the holy month for Muslims, began

In this sense, shopping malls and restaurants are allowed to reopen with limitations in their capacity. For this, it must strictly comply with social distancing.

However, children between the ages of 3 and 12, as well as people over the age of 60 cannot leave their homes. Although this measure is strict, the purpose is to preserve the well-being of this age group that is most vulnerable to this deadly virus.

Two-hour curfew reduction in Dubai – United Arab Emirates

Authorities in the United Arab Emirates (UAE) have recently reported a two-hour decrease in the curfew. This measure was triggered due to the coronavirus pandemic

In this context, the city of Dubai has reopened its main beaches and parks.

Emirati state news agency WAM expressed the following:

“The Emirati Government has indicated that the curfew will be in force between 10pm and 6am (local time), so it will start two hours later than until now”

The Dubai Mayor’s Office has indicated that the beaches and parks have reopened during the day. To this end, it calls for public awareness to respect and comply with security measures.

UAE authorities reported that normal dynamics will be restored on June 10. All this is amid the progressive normalization of activities.
